Nutrients Found in Green Tea

After water, green tea is the world’s most popular drink. Asian and Chinese people have relied on this beverage for its medicinal properties since ancient times.

It originates from the Camellia Sinensis plant’s leaves. Green tea isn’t oxidized like oolong and black teas are, thus it doesn’t have the same flavor.

Epigallocatechin-3-gallate (EGCG) is a catechin found in green tea that has been shown to have health benefits. The polyphenols and antioxidants found in abundance have been linked to numerous positive health effects.
